Advertisement

基于SVM的神经网络数据分类预测在葡萄酒种类识别中的应用

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本研究运用支持向量机(SVM)与神经网络结合的方法,对葡萄酒进行种类识别和分类预测。通过优化算法参数,提高了模型准确性,为葡萄酒质量评估提供有效工具。 本代码主要使用MATLAB工具进行SVM神经网络的数据分类预测仿真,实现葡萄酒种类识别的模拟。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• SVM
    优质
    本研究运用支持向量机(SVM)与神经网络结合的方法,对葡萄酒进行种类识别和分类预测。通过优化算法参数,提高了模型准确性,为葡萄酒质量评估提供有效工具。 本代码主要使用MATLAB工具进行SVM神经网络的数据分类预测仿真,实现葡萄酒种类识别的模拟。
  • SVM-SVM_svm_svm_matlabsvm_
    优质
    本研究运用支持向量机(SVM)技术对葡萄酒种类进行数据分析、分类及预测。通过Matlab平台实现算法优化,提高分类准确度和识别效率。 MATLAB源码:使用SVM神经网络进行葡萄酒种类识别的数据分类预测。
  • MATLABSVM——意大利.rar
    优质
    本项目利用MATLAB平台下的支持向量机(SVM)算法对意大利葡萄酒进行种类分类和预测。通过分析化学成分数据,实现高效的葡萄酒类型识别。 基于SVM的数据分类预测——意大利葡萄酒种类识别(使用MATLAB 14)
  • BP算法研究
    优质
    本研究探讨了BP神经网络算法在葡萄酒种类识别的应用,通过构建模型对不同品种的葡萄酒进行分类和识别,旨在提高分类准确度。 随着我国葡萄酒行业的发展,葡萄酒生产企业的规模与数量不断增加。然而,在面对进口酒的激烈竞争以及质量检测体系不明确导致的市场混乱的情况下,中国葡萄酒业仍面临诸多挑战。本段落分析了人工品尝在评估葡萄酒质量问题上的不足,并探讨如何通过数据挖掘技术提高识别不同等级葡萄酒准确性的方法,这对促进我国葡萄酒市场的稳定发展和提升产品质量具有实际应用价值。 在数据分析过程中常遇到不平衡样本的问题:少数类的影响力较小,这意味着即便不考虑这些少数类别也能获得较高的分类准确性。本段落提出了一种创新的方法——从不平衡的数据集中提取平衡子集进行建模,并反复循环这一过程以预测测试数据的结果,最终选择出现频率最高的结果作为最终输出,这种方法显著提高了低质量葡萄酒识别率。 具体而言,在实验中应用了BP神经网络技术来对意大利某一区域内三种不同类型的葡萄酒的化学成分进行模式识别。该研究的数据包含178个样本,每个样本具有13种特征参数,并且已经确定类别标签。其中65%用于训练模型构建,其余35%作为测试集以评估模型性能。 通过这种方法的应用能够有效提高对低质量葡萄酒的检测能力,对于提升我国葡萄酒产业的整体水平具有积极意义。
  • SVM意大利
    优质
    本研究采用支持向量机(SVM)算法对意大利葡萄酒的不同品种进行分类预测。通过分析化学成分数据,实现高效准确的葡萄酒类型识别。 这是一个基于SVM的数据分类预测的Matlab程序,用于识别意大利葡萄酒种类。该程序包含一个.m文件和一个.mat数据集,可以直接使用。
  • SVM意大利
    优质
    本研究采用支持向量机(SVM)模型对意大利葡萄酒进行种类预测与分类。通过分析化学成分特征,实现了高精度的葡萄酒类型识别。 SVM数据分类预测——意大利葡萄酒种类识别的Matlab源程序与数据
  • SVM意大利.7z
    优质
    本研究利用支持向量机(SVM)算法对意大利葡萄酒数据进行分析,实现不同种类葡萄酒的精准分类与预测。 可以将这178个样本的50%作为训练集,剩余的50%作为测试集。使用训练集对支持向量机(SVM)进行训练以建立分类模型,并用该模型预测测试集中数据的类别标签。
  • SVM意大利.zip
    优质
    本项目利用支持向量机(SVM)算法对意大利葡萄酒的数据进行分析和处理,旨在准确预测不同类型的意大利葡萄酒。通过科学的方法实现高效的葡萄酒种类分类预测,为相关领域提供有价值的参考。 在当今的数据科学领域,数据分类预测是一个重要的研究方向,并且涉及到了机器学习算法的广泛应用。支持向量机(SVM)作为一种常用的监督学习方法,在分类和回归分析中具有显著的优势。其核心思想是寻找一个最优的超平面来实现不同类别的划分,从而最大化分类间隔并达到准确分类的目的。 本篇研究利用MATLAB软件平台并通过神经网络工具箱对意大利葡萄酒种类进行识别。这不仅涉及到了数据预处理、特征提取和模型构建等步骤,并且展示了如何运用MATLAB神经网络工具箱解决实际问题的过程。 在基于SVM的数据分类预测之前,首先需要深入分析意大利葡萄酒数据集。该数据集通常包含了不同葡萄酒的多个化学成分,例如酸度、糖分含量及含水量等。通过这些测量值,SVM模型能够预测出葡萄酒的具体种类。构建SVM模型前,研究人员需进行一系列预处理步骤:包括去除异常值和噪声的数据清洗工作;将不同量纲数据标准化到同一尺度上;以及确定哪些化学成分对于分类结果最为重要的特征选择。 在MATLAB环境中,借助神经网络工具箱可以便捷地开发与测试SVM模型。该工具有丰富的函数接口支持如使用`fitcsvm`训练SVM分类器、利用`predict`对新数据进行预测等操作。此外,通过交叉验证和网格搜索方法来优化选择最佳的模型参数是提高性能的关键步骤。 本研究还探讨了神经网络的应用价值。MATLAB神经网络工具箱涵盖了从单层感知机到复杂的多层前馈及循环网络的各种设计类型,在葡萄酒种类识别任务中能有效学习复杂非线性关系,有助于提升分类准确性。相对SVM而言,神经网络在处理大规模数据集和解决非线性问题时具备独特优势。 研究项目除了主要源代码文件外还可能包含相关数据、模型参数及帮助文档等附件内容,《MATLAB 神经网络43个案例分析》目录.docx描述了研究背景、目标与方法,而chapter14则提供了第14个案例的深入讨论。这些资料对于理解整个项目的研究思路和实验过程至关重要。 本项研究旨在利用SVM及MATLAB神经网络工具箱实现对意大利葡萄酒种类的准确识别,并通过详细的数据分析、模型构建与优化最终获得一个可靠分类预测系统,不仅有助于相关行业进行质量控制和品种鉴别工作,也为机器学习在食品行业的应用提供了有力例证。
  • SVMMATLAB程序
    优质
    本简介介绍了一种使用支持向量机(SVM)算法在MATLAB平台上进行葡萄酒类别的自动分类程序。该程序通过机器学习技术有效地区分不同类型的葡萄酒,为酒品分析提供了便捷和高效的解决方案。 Matlab支持向量机(SVM)葡萄酒分类程序。这段文字在重写后为:如何使用MATLAB编写一个基于支持向量机(SVM)的葡萄酒分类程序?
  • SVM.pdf
    优质
    本论文采用支持向量机(SVM)算法对葡萄酒数据集进行分类研究,通过优化参数提升模型准确性,为酒品质量评估提供有效工具。 支持向量机(SVM)是一种常用的监督学习算法,适用于二分类及多分类问题。它通过构建一个能够最大化不同类别样本间隔的超平面来进行分类。 在葡萄酒数据集上应用SVM进行分类时,可以采用线性SVM和非线性SVM两种方法。此外,还可以使用核函数来增强模型的表现力,如高斯核(RBF)和支持向量机中的多项式核等。这些不同的配置允许我们根据具体问题选择最合适的参数。 通过这种方式学习支持向量机算法在实际数据集上的应用,可以加深对如何将理论知识与实践相结合的理解。